accept to say yes when someone wants to give you something.
boat an open vehicle, smaller than a ship, that moves on water.
burn to be on fire.
double two times the amount or number.
hockey a game played on ice by two teams. Each person wears skates and carries a long stick.
microphone a device that changes sound waves into electronic signals. Microphones are used to make sounds louder or to broadcast or record them.
port a place where ships load, or the town or city near this place.
protect to defend or keep safe from danger or harm.
rent the regular payment that you give to the owner of a property for the use of a space.
scare to frighten.
seem to appear to be or do.
small little in size, number, or amount.
song a short piece of music for singing.
spray water or other liquid flying or falling through the air in fine drops; mist.
sunny having weather in which the sky is blue and clouds do not block the light of the sun.
